Explore the vast desert plateau of northern Mexico, rich in Spanish colonial history and home to key cities like Chihuahua and Monterrey. This region includes important crossings on the Rio Grande and notable tourist spots along the Copper Canyon rail line.

A detailed look at the historic and cultural highlights of Chihuahua and Coahuila states in northern Mexico.

Northern Mexico features a sprawling desert-like landscape deeply influenced by its Spanish colonial past. The town of Presidio holds the distinction of being the earliest settlement within what is now the United States, predating even Jamestown. Today, it remains one of the few crossings over the Rio Grande into Texas, a state that itself was once part of Mexico.

The region boasts two major cities: Chihuahua, situated about 300 kilometers south of El Paso, and Monterrey, the largest urban center in northern Mexico. Visitors can also explore popular destinations such as Monclova, Saltillo, Parras, Torreon, and Cuauhtemoc, which marks the end of the famed Copper Canyon railway.

The map extends slightly into Sinaloa to include Los Mochis on the Pacific coast, showing the entire rail line. This area represents a significant chapter in North American history, often overlooked by European travelers who tend to favor the Yucatan’s beaches.

Ciudad Juarez stands out as a bustling city on the Rio Grande, even larger than its Texan counterpart, El Paso. The map also features an inset of Saltillo, the historic colonial city, alongside a list of top attractions to guide your journey.
